将来サポートされる可能性が高い配列メソッドです。
現在は一部のブラウザでは実行できません。
●配列の位置を取得(
Mozillaは未サポート)
Array.indexOf(val);
val・・・・Index値を確認したい値
格納している要素のインデックス値を調べます。
Array.lastIndexOf(val);
val・・・Index値を確認したい値(後ろから)
確認している要素のインデックス値を後ろから何番目かを取得します。
●配列を繰り返し処理(I.E未サポート)
・Array.forEach(testFunction)
testFunction・・・・繰り返し処理したい関数
関数は以下のように実装します。
/** 5未満の値は削除する */
function testFunction(element,index,array){
if(element <5){
array.splice(index,1);
}
}
PR